FAY'S INC. v. PETER'S GROCERIES, INC.


227 A.D.2d 970 (1996)

644 N.Y.S.2d 115

Fay's Incorporated, Appellant, et al., Plaintiff, v. Peter's Groceries, Inc., Respondent

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Fourth Department.

May 31, 1996


Order unanimously affirmed without costs.

Memorandum:

Supreme Court properly denied plaintiff's motion for summary judgment. Plaintiff commenced this action seeking a declaration concerning the computation of rent and other payments due under a commercial lease signed in 1975 and amended twice. We agree with plaintiff that the lease unambiguously provides for a rental increase of 2% based upon an advance in the Consumer Price Index (CPI) of 10%, not 10 points...
